Sinopse

A homicide detective teams up with an evolutionary biologist to hunt a giant creature that is killing people in a Chicago museum.

More than a little genuinely funny dialogue, and I think the creature had a pretty cool design... I'm pretty sure? I don't know though, because every time it appears it's in virtually complete darkness. _Final rating:★★½ - Had a lot that appealed to me, didn’t quite work as a whole._
